Xref: news-dnh.mv.net comp.os.msdos.djgpp:2707 Newsgroups: comp.os.msdos.djgpp Path: news-dnh.mv.net!mv!news.sprintlink.net!in1.uu.net!psinntp!psinntp!psinntp!psinntp!netrixgw.netrix.com!root From: ld AT jasmine DOT netrix DOT com (Long Doan) Subject: Re: Q: Floating point exceptions handling. How ? Lines: 23 Sender: root AT netrix DOT com Organization: Netrix Corporation References: Date: Mon, 16 Oct 1995 17:21:13 GMT To: djgpp AT sun DOT soe DOT clarkson DOT edu Dj-Gateway: from newsgroup comp.os.msdos.djgpp In article Vladimir Pshenkin writes: > Please help! > I use a lot of numerical methodth in my project - but now > I have a seriouse problem - how can I handle SIGFPE under GCC ? > Any solutions ? > signal(...) doesn't works. why ? 1. In version 2+, signal () should work. 2. In version 1.xx, DPMI mode, you need to have a DPMI host that can emulate the FPU (Windows' ???) 3. In version 1.xx, non-DPMI mode, just write a handler for the apropriate exception, and use _go32_dpmi_... to install it. Or you can just use a emulator (emu387 or something). Long. -- ============================================================== Long Doan ld AT netrix DOT com Netrix Corporation ldoan1 AT osf1 DOT gmu DOT edu 13595 Dulles Technology Drive Herndon Va 22071 ==============================================================